Scott AFB Exchange shoppers can save 15 percent off first-day purchases
Military shoppers at the Scott AFB Exchange can get a jump on their holiday shopping with an extra discount on first-day purchases with a new MILITARY STAR card through the Army & Air Force Exchange Service.
Shoppers who use a new card for the first time from Oct. 28-Nov. 10 will receive a 15 percent discount on all purchases instead of the standard 10 percent discount that is regularly offered.
The discount is valid in-store at Scott AFB Exchange facilities and online at shopmyexchange.com and can be combined with other promotions. The discount will appear as a credit on shoppers’ first billing statements.
Each time cardholders make a purchase with their MILITARY STAR card, they earn points as part of a rewards program.
Cardholders earn two points for every $1 spent in Exchange stores, food courts, mall vendors and on shopmyexchange.com.
Shoppers automatically receive a $20 MILITARY STAR Rewards Card for every 2,000 points earned. The card can be redeemed anywhere Exchange gift cards are accepted.
Other benefits of the card include:
▪ Competitive interest rate of 10.49 percent—an industry-leading interest rate;
▪ No annual, late or over-limit fees;
▪ 10 percent off Exchange food court purchases;
▪ 5-cents-per-gallon savings at Exchange gas stations; and
▪ Free standard shipping at shopmyexchange.com.
